What is the Bord Bia SBLAS ?

The Sustainable Beef and Lamb Assurance Scheme which is also known as SBLAS is run by Bord Bia. The idea of Bord Bia SBLAS consists of setting out the agreed standards for production and certification of Irish Beef and Lamb. Continue reading “”

Herdwatch hits Ireland’s Largest Energy Event for Farmers

The Energy in Agriculture event 2017 will take place on August 22nd in Gurteen College

The “Energy in Agriculture 2017” event which is currently Ireland’s largest energy event for farmers, will take place on Tuesday, August 22nd at Gurteen College, Co. Tipperary. The event itself is organised by Teagasc, Tipperary County Council, IFA, Tipperary Energy Agency and Gurteen College. The whole aim of the event is to provide practical information for farmers and the rural sector about the various renewable energy and energy efficiency options available for farm businesses.

Farm Safety Week 2017: The Dangers of Slurry

Dangers of slurry while spreading

Today’s theme of Farm Safety Week being “livestock and slurry” so we are going to look at the business of spreading slurry. While a majority of this year’s slurry has already been spread we take a look at the dangers of slurry; how it’s taken so many lives and if there are any ways to reduce the risks to yourself, and your family, when you are out there performing the task. According to a 2016 article in The Independent “In the period 2000-2010, 30% of child fatal accidents on farms were caused by drowning in slurry or water.”
